## Indications for Use

The Olympus Lyophilized Chemistry Calibrator is a two level general purpose chemistry calibrator designed to provide suitable calibration levels for OLYMPUS analyzers employing the OLYMPUS Methodologies.

## Device Story

Olympus Lyophilized Chemistry Calibrator is a two-level, general-purpose chemistry calibrator; used to calibrate Olympus analyzers; ensures accuracy of clinical chemistry testing; supports clinical decision-making by providing reference points for patient sample analysis; intended for professional use in clinical laboratory settings.

## Clinical Evidence

No clinical data. Bench testing only. Stability was verified through open-vial aging studies (2-8 °C) and accelerated stability testing (37 °C). Traceability of constituent analytes was established via NIST standards or third-party reference materials. Lactic acid concentration was verified using an Olympus colorimetric kit.

## Regulatory Identification

A calibrator is a device intended for medical purposes for use in a test system to establish points of reference that are used in the determination of values in the measurement of substances in human specimens. (See also § 862.2 in this part.)

I. Device Description:

The existing calibrator family consists of 2 products. Each product is offered in small and large sizes. As sold, the product consists of a vial of powder and a vial of liquid. Calibrants are present in both vials. The user dissolves the powder in a pre-determined volume of the provided liquid before use.

The first product, referred to as Level I by the submitter, is unaffected by this submission. The submitter proposes the addition of lactate to the 2nd or "Level II" product.

3. Comparison with predicate:

The currently marketed predicate device claims the presence of a number of analytes. The concentrations of these analytes vary slightly between batches and with the particular product subset. Representative concentrations for analytes common to both the predicate and pre-market device are noted in the table below. The actual, certified concentration is noted on the product insert for each batch.

|  Similarities (Present in Proposed Device and Predicate)  |   |
| --- | --- |
|  Constituent(Level II (reconstituted)) | Level II Target Concentration and (Range)  |
|  Albumin | 4.0 (3.6-4.4) g/dL  |
|  Bicarbonate | 40 (36-44) mEq/L  |
|  Calcium (Arsenazo Application)* | 12.0 (11.5-12.5) mg/dL  |
|  Calcium (OPC Application) | 12.0 (11.5-12.5) mg/dL  |
|  Cholesterol | 220 (198-242) mg/dL  |
|  Creatinine | 6.0 (5.4-6.6) mg/dL  |
|  Creatinine STAT* | 6.0 (5.4-6.6) mg/dL  |
|  Glucose | 250 (225-275) mg/dL  |
|  Glucose STAT* | 250 (225-275) mg/dL  |
|  Inorganic Phosphorous | 5.0 (4.5-5.5) mg/dL  |
|  Magnesium | 3.0 (2.7-3.3) mg/dL
2.5 (2.25-2.75) mEq/L  |
|  Total Protein | 7.2 (6.5-7.9) g/dL  |
|  Triglyceride | 250 (225-275) mg/dL  |
|  UIBC | 270 (243-297) ug/dL  |
|  Urea Nitrogen (BUN) | 50 (45-55) mg/dL  |
|  Urea Nitrogen STAT* | 50 (45-55) mg/dL  |
|  Uric Acid | 8.0 (7.2-8.8) mg/dL  |

*These assays not available for AU5200 Analyzer

|  Differences  |   |   |
| --- | --- | --- |
|  Constituent(Level II (reconstituted)) | Proposed Level II Target Concentration and (Range) | Predicate (K032665)  |
|  Lactate | 40 (35 – 45) mg/dL | Not Present  |

c. Traceability, Stability, Expected values (controls, calibrators, or methods):

The predicate and pre-market devices serve as calibrators for specific Olympus clinical laboratory equipment. The stability and traceability of the component analytes are the primary criteria for acceptance.

Traceability is handled via the selection and documentation of the source material. The majority of the constituent calibrants can be traced to the National Institute of Standards and Technology. Two calibrants can be traced to 3rd party standard suppliers, New England Reagent Laboratories and Certified Reference Material. Lactic acid concentration is calculated via an Olympus colorimetric kit.

Stability is measured by:

- Open vial aging which mimics handling by the users of the product. These studies involve verifying concentration of the reconstituted analytes when the product is stored capped but unsealed at 2 °C to 8 °C.
- Accelerated Stability Testing which involves storing tested samples at elevated temperatures (37 °C) in an effort to predict their long-term performance.

The reported stability is within the error limits stated with the product. The measured stability is consistent with the shelf life claimed on the product insert.
